GLORIA JEAN APPLEBY was born on January 7, 1942, to Frank and Gladys (Kessel) Howland, in Lakewood, Ohio. She peacefully passed away on Monday, January 1, 2024 at 81 years of age. A devoted life companion of Homer Lemon, they spent their later years in Brunswick, Ohio. She was a beloved mother to Rick Appleby, Jess Appleby, Laurie (Rick) Dales, Michele (late Frank) Chismody, Gloria (George) Turner, and Fred (Amber) Appleby. She was a cherished grandmother to Lisa Pietrzycki, Megan Laycock, Corey Dales, Randy Turner, Frank Chismody, Keith Chismody, Brittney McCashland, Kayla Patterson, Jennifer Appleby, and Skyler Appleby. Gloria was also a great-grandmother to 19 beautiful souls. She was the dear sister of Linda Sprong, late Janet Frish, and Terry Howland. Memorial Service, Thursday, January 11, 2024 at 4:00 pm at Baker-Osinski-Kensinger Funeral Home, 206 Front Street, Berea, Ohio, 44017, where friends may gather Thursday from 2:00-4:00 pm.
Gloria's life was marked by the deep love she had for her family, and she cherished the moments spent together during family gatherings. Her passion for floral design, gardening, and various crafts reflected her creative spirit. Gloria found joy in the simplicity of camping and had a special place in her heart for the soulful tunes of bluegrass music. She leaves behind a legacy of love, warmth, and creativity. For several years, Gloria was a member at the Fraternal Order of Eagles #3505 Brunswick, Ohio. Gloria will be dearly missed by all who had the privilege of knowing her. May she rest in eternal peace, surrounded by the beauty and love she brought into the lives of those around her.
